$5,000 to Win R&R Open Street Stock Race Headlines This Friday Night at Lee

Lee, NH — August 26, 2025 — Lee USA Speedway is set to roar back to life this Friday night with one of the biggest short track events of the summer: the R&R Open Street Stock Showdown, paying $5,000 to win. The prestigious open-competition race will showcase some of the region’s top Street Stock talent battling under the lights at New Hampshire’s Center of Speed.

Fans can expect bumper-to-bumper action, high-intensity racing, and plenty of drama as drivers chase the impressive payday and the bragging rights that come with conquering Lee’s fast 3/8-mile oval. With the largest Street Stock purse of the year on the line, the stakes have never been higher.

In addition to the headlining showdown, the night will feature a full card of support divisions and even school busses, bringing fans nonstop entertainment from start to finish. Whether you’re a longtime race fan or new to the sport, Friday’s event promises excitement for the whole family.

Event Details:
• What: R&R Open Street Stock Race – $5,000 to Win
• Where: Lee USA Speedway, Lee, NH
• When: Friday, August 29th, 2025 – Racing begins at 7:00 PM

Tickets will be available at the gate, with affordable family pricing to ensure everyone can enjoy a night of short track tradition and excitement. Concessions and the popular Turn One Tower & Bar will be open for fans looking to upgrade their race night experience.
